Abstract

In one embodiment, a method includes receiving a touch sensor substrate associated with a plurality of electrodes and a plurality of connection pads. The plurality of electrodes is configured to detect a touch. The plurality of connection pads are configured to be electrically coupled with a touch controller. The method further includes laser etching a plurality of paths. The method also includes filling the plurality of paths with an electrically conductive material to form a plurality of tracks. Each track is configured to electrically couple at least one connection pad of the plurality of connection pads with at least one electrode of the plurality of electrodes.
